1About the position:
Emergency Management (EM) Advisor is responsible for stewarding the Emergency Management process, supporting business units in developing and maintaining emergency response plans, coordinating drills and 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ements related to EM. The Emergency Management Advisor reports to the Workforce Safey Team Lead in the Chevron Engine in Bengaluru, India.
Key responsibilities:
  • Steward the Emergency Management (EM) process and support Business Units (BU) in developing and maintaining their emergency response plans
  • Coordinate, plan and deliver emergency response training programs for BUs
  • Support business unit compliance with regulatory requirements related to EM with federal, state, and local government agencies as needed
  • Support BUs in assigned region with help in mutual aid, emergency response plans, and drills
  • Support BU EM Advisors in developing and maintaining Emergency Response, Crisis Management and Spill Contingency Plans, including drills, training, and notifications as required
  • Provide subject matter expertise and technical advice on specific EM projects and mentor local workforce on EM processes
  • Support development and maintenance of Oil Spill Response Plans, Fire Protection Plans and Emergency Response Plans
  • Act as Crisis Management Advisor as needed to support crisis management and emergency response activations
  • Support connections with Third Party vendors to establish Statement of Work (SoW) for technical, exercise, and training support, as well as emergency preparedness and response drills
  • Support the BU's overall emergency preparedness and response efforts, including business continuity and crisis management
  • Support Chevron Emergency Response Team Responder Certifications and Medical Clearances
Required Qualifications:
  • Knowledge and experience in emergency preparedness, including risk profiles and alignment of response plans
  • Proficiency in the Incident Command System (ICS) with relevant certifications (ICS 100, 200, 220, 300, 320)
  • Experience with field emergency response, oil spill tactics, fire/explosion responses, and regulatory compliance
  • Familiarity with federal, state, and local emergency response requirements and frameworks
  • Experience in oil and gas operations or similar industries
  • Strong analytical skills, problem-solving abilities, and project execution track record
  • Ability to build and sustain positive relationships with internal and external stakeholders
  • Expertise in managing multiple stakeholders and day to day tasks
  • Ability to use Microsoft Office suite (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
  • Experience with relevant tools such as concur, is an added advantage
Chevron ENGINE supports global operations, supporting business requirements across the world. Accordingly, the work hours for employees will be aligned to support business requirements. The standard work week will be Monday to Friday. Working hours are 8:00am to 5:00pm or 1.30pm to 10.30pm.
